    Just got my tune from ..Speed Tuning USA...my experience

    Guest-only advertisement. Register or Log In now!
    What up guys.........
    So Have been looking around to get a tune for the TT.
    The last tune I had done was an APR about 7 years ago on my A4....loved it and noticed the performance right away.....thought WOW only $500 for this extra power!! yay
    Now since my last tune was almost 7 years ago...I figured there had to be more options than the BIG 3 now a days.....WE know who they are.
    Found a place in Maryland called Speed Tuning USA on google.
    Read lots of favorable testimony from people on more than a few forums and decided to get in touch with them to get a feel for there company and what I was in for before and after the tune.
    Talked to Oliver who seems to be "THE GUY"....He was more than easy to talk to and said bottom line....30hp and 75TQ........on par with the big 3.
    There tunes ordered from the site are $250......wow thats half what I expected to pay.
    As it turns out they auction there tunes on Ebay as well as sell from there site.
    Found there listing on the Bay and read there feedback.....5 star 100% nearly a thousand positives......nice...very nice
    Now I knew the site was selling the tune for $250....and the ebay starting bid was at $125...with a BIN of $150.
    Both prices included return priority shipping.
    So I thought about it...good forum reviews+nearly 1000 positive Feedbacks on Ebay+$125 initial bid = no brainier to me..press the bid button!!!
    We have a winner!! auction ended at $125 with free usps priority back to me...I choose to pay additional for over night.
    I sent the ecu out this Monday via usps...only $18 flatrate over night..sweet.
    They received it at 11:30 yesterday...I know this because Oliver called me to ask me if I had any further questions.
    I asked ...remove top speed limiter and raise rev limit plus the EXTRA POWER Please.......He said done and it would be in the mail sent overnight by 5pm.
    Mr.mailman knocked on my door at lunchtime to deliver the ecu....
    Ran out to the garage and 20 mins later.......I was back on the road.
    Now I put nearly 300 miles with the chip today and all I can say is.........OMG....feels just like when I got the APR tune in the old A4.
    However this time I thought.......WoW only $143 for this extra power!! and I saved $357...YAY.
    Now there are those of you that will say....yea but its not a proven tune or you get what you pay for............
    In my mind and butt dyno I received exactly what I felt from the APR tune....and that made my wallet or should I say debit card feel alot heavier lols

    only things I also added were a Forge DV and K&N filter.
    Planing on goin test pipe next....I believe that is supposed to be another decent boost in hp
